How Does Sonic Healthcare Reach Its Customers?

The sales channels of Sonic Healthcare are primarily built around direct engagement within the healthcare ecosystem. The company focuses on a multi-faceted approach to reach patients and clinicians. This strategy includes a strong physical presence, direct sales teams, and digital platforms.

A key component of the Sonic Healthcare sales strategy involves its extensive network of physical collection centers and laboratories. These locations serve as direct points of contact for patients and healthcare providers, facilitating the delivery of medical laboratory services. Complementing this physical infrastructure, direct sales teams actively cultivate relationships with general practitioners, specialists, hospitals, and community health services.

Digital channels, such as the company's website, play a crucial role in providing information and facilitating access to services. These platforms offer test information, patient resources, and, in certain regions, online appointment scheduling and results delivery. This omnichannel approach aims to provide seamless access to services, regardless of the entry point, which is crucial for the company's business model.

Icon Physical Collection Centers and Laboratories

These are direct points of contact for patients and clinicians. They provide a physical presence for sample collection and test processing. This channel is fundamental to the company's operations, ensuring accessibility and direct service delivery.

Icon Direct Sales Teams

Sales teams focus on building and maintaining relationships with healthcare professionals. They engage with general practitioners, specialists, hospitals, and community health services. This channel is crucial for securing referrals and driving revenue growth.

Icon Website and Digital Platforms

The company website serves as an informational hub, providing access to test information and patient resources. Online portals for clinicians enhance efficiency by allowing test ordering and results access. Digital platforms are increasingly important for patient engagement and service delivery.

Icon Key Partnerships

Strategic alliances with hospitals and healthcare systems are vital. These partnerships allow the company to become the preferred diagnostic provider within these networks. They contribute significantly to market share and revenue by securing large volumes of diagnostic testing.

What Marketing Tactics Does Sonic Healthcare Use?

The marketing tactics of the provided company are designed to reinforce its reputation for medical excellence, reliability, and patient-centric care. Given its business-to-business (B2B) and business-to-clinician (B2C) nature, content marketing plays a crucial role. The company focuses on providing valuable information to healthcare professionals and patients alike.

The company's strategy includes a mix of digital and traditional marketing methods. Digital strategies are becoming increasingly important, with an emphasis on educational content and digital accessibility. The marketing mix has evolved to meet the changing landscape of healthcare information consumption.

The company's marketing approach is data-driven, analyzing referral patterns, clinician feedback, and patient demographics to tailor service offerings and communication strategies. This helps in understanding the needs of the target audience and improving customer relationships.

Icon

Content Marketing

Content marketing is a key element of the company's strategy, involving the publication of scientific papers, clinical guidelines, and educational materials. These resources are often distributed through medical conferences, professional associations, and direct communication channels. This approach helps establish the company as a leader in the Healthcare diagnostics market.

Icon

Search Engine Optimization (SEO)

SEO is vital for ensuring that clinicians and patients can easily find information about specific tests, services, and nearby collection centers online. Effective SEO helps the company improve its visibility in search results, making it easier for potential customers to access information and services. This is crucial for the company's Sonic Healthcare sales strategy.

Icon

Traditional Marketing

While traditional mass media advertising is less prevalent, targeted print advertisements in medical journals and participation in industry events remain relevant. This approach helps the company maintain a presence within the medical community and reach its target audience effectively. The company's Sonic Healthcare marketing strategy incorporates traditional methods.

Icon

Digital Marketing

Digital tactics are increasingly important, including email marketing to disseminate updates on new tests, clinical insights, and service enhancements to referring practitioners. Collaborations with key opinion leaders in the medical field serve a similar purpose, lending credibility and disseminating information. The company uses a Sonic Healthcare digital marketing strategy.

Icon

Social Media

Social media platforms, particularly professional networking sites, are used for corporate communications, recruitment, and sharing scientific advancements. This helps the company build its brand and engage with its target audience. Social media is part of the company's Sonic Healthcare brand awareness strategies.

Icon

Data-Driven Marketing

The company's approach to data-driven marketing involves analyzing referral patterns, clinician feedback, and patient demographics to tailor service offerings and communication strategies. This data-driven approach is crucial for the company's Sonic Healthcare business model. The company uses CRM systems to manage clinician relationships and analytics tools to track website engagement.

How Is Sonic Healthcare Positioned in the Market?

The brand positioning of the company centers on its leadership in medical diagnostics. It emphasizes core values such as medical integrity and diagnostic excellence. This approach builds a brand identity around trust, precision, and comprehensive service, crucial elements in the Growth Strategy of Sonic Healthcare.

The core message focuses on providing accurate and timely diagnostic information. This empowers clinicians to make informed decisions, ultimately improving patient outcomes. The visual identity, while adapted across its global operations, consistently communicates professionalism and clinical authority. The tone of voice is informative, reassuring, and expert-driven, resonating with its target audience.

The company's appeal to clinicians and patients is built on its reputation for high-quality results and extensive test menus. Its unique selling proposition involves its vast network of accredited laboratories and imaging centers. It also emphasizes medical leadership and direct pathologist/radiologist engagement, setting it apart in the competitive healthcare diagnostics market.

Icon Brand Values

The company emphasizes medical integrity, diagnostic excellence, and patient care. These values are central to its brand identity and are consistently communicated across all touchpoints.

Icon Target Audience

The primary target audience includes clinicians and, by extension, their patients. The company's services are designed to meet the needs of healthcare professionals.

Icon Unique Selling Proposition (USP)

The company's USP lies in its extensive network of accredited laboratories and imaging centers. It also emphasizes medical leadership and direct pathologist/radiologist engagement.

Icon Brand Consistency

Brand consistency is maintained through rigorous quality standards and a unified approach to service delivery. This ensures a consistent brand experience across all operations.

What Are Sonic Healthcare’s Most Notable Campaigns?

In the context of its B2B and B2C healthcare services, the term 'campaigns' for the company often refers to strategic initiatives rather than traditional advertising drives. This approach is tailored to the company's business model, which focuses on medical laboratory services and diagnostic imaging industry. These initiatives are crucial for maintaining its position in the healthcare diagnostics market.

One of the primary focuses of the company is the continuous integration and optimization of acquired businesses. This strategy is key to its expansion and market share. For example, the company's acquisition of GLP Systems in 2024 strengthens its presence in laboratory automation, demonstrating its commitment to growth.

Another significant initiative involves the adoption of new diagnostic technologies, such as advanced genomic testing or artificial intelligence in radiology. These efforts are supported by targeted outreach and educational materials aimed at clinicians and healthcare providers. This approach is a key component of the company's sales strategy, helping to drive adoption of advanced services.

Icon Ongoing Integration and Optimization

The company continuously integrates and optimizes acquired businesses to expand its global footprint and service offerings. This includes streamlining operations and leveraging synergies across its network. Success is measured by seamless transitions, sustained referral volumes, and improved efficiencies.

Icon Adoption of New Diagnostic Technologies

The company focuses on the adoption of advanced diagnostic technologies like genomic testing and AI in radiology. This involves strategic communication and education for clinicians.
